What “Task Workflow Software” Means for Healthcare Administration
This solution is designed to manage tasks as structured work units with defined states, required fields, responsible roles, and measurable outcomes. Instead of treating work as emails and checklists, you track it as a workflow your organization can improve over time.
Key workflow capabilities tailored to healthcare administration
- Configurable task flows for repeatable internal processes
- Role-based responsibilities so each step has an accountable owner
- Status tracking and escalations to prevent silent delays
- Automated reminders and routing to reduce manual follow-up
- Attachments and documentation links for supporting evidence
- Audit-friendly activity history for traceability

How We Build Your Healthcare Administration Workflow (Without Disrupting Operations)
A workflow system must reflect your existing practices while improving them. Allquill follows a structured process that prioritizes clarity, control, and continuity.
Our implementation approach in plain terms
-
Discovery & workflow mapping
We document your current process, identify bottlenecks, and define what “complete” means for each workflow. -
Workflow design & configuration
We configure task states, roles, routing rules, required fields, and step dependencies. -
Development & integration
Where needed, we integrate with your existing internal tools and data sources to reduce duplicate work. -
Testing and workflow validation
We validate the workflow logic with realistic scenarios your team actually faces. -
Launch & enablement for internal teams
We ensure teams can use the system confidently, including how tasks should move and where to find status. -
Ongoing support and iteration
As your operations evolve, we refine the workflow to match new internal requirements.
